1. The Architecture of Bonus Pools – From Deposit Match to Community Fund

When a player deposits AED 1,000 and receives a 100 % match, the casino’s back‑end creates two parallel entries: a “player credit” ledger for wagering and a “bonus pool” ledger for accounting. All bonus credits across the site flow into a central pool that is mathematically distinct from the cash‑handling ledger.

Static allocation model – The simplest algorithm applies a fixed percentage, often 5 %, of every bonus credit to a community‑impact budget. For example, a €50 free spin bundle contributes €2.50 to the fund automatically. This model is easy to audit but can be inefficient during low‑traffic periods.

Dynamic scaling model – More sophisticated platforms use a variable rate that reacts to player activity. An algorithm might start at 3 % and increase to 8 % once the cumulative wagering volume exceeds a threshold (e.g., $10 million per month). The formula can be expressed as:

CommunityRate = BaseRate + (WagerVolume / VolumeCap) * RateSlope

If the wager volume is half of the cap, the rate climbs halfway between the base and maximum. This dynamic approach rewards high‑traffic periods with larger donations, creating a positive feedback loop: more players → higher community contributions → stronger brand reputation → even more players.

Benefits of a Tiered Pool Structure

  • Predictability – Operators can forecast quarterly donation amounts based on projected wagering.
  • Flexibility – Seasonal promotions (e.g., Ramadan charity spin) can temporarily boost the community rate without altering the core algorithm.
  • Transparency – Separate ledgers simplify regulatory reporting, especially in jurisdictions like the UAE where AML compliance is stringent.

A comparison of static versus dynamic allocation is shown below:

Feature Static % Model Dynamic Scaling Model
Implementation complexity Low Medium–High
Responsiveness to traffic None High
Predictable donation amount Yes Variable
Player perception Fixed benefit Incentivized growth

By isolating bonus credits into a dedicated pool, casinos create a clean data stream that can be tapped by downstream systems—smart contracts, analytics engines, and NGO APIs—without contaminating the core cash flow.

2. Smart Contracts and Blockchain Transparency in Bonus‑Driven Giving

Blockchain technology has moved beyond cryptocurrency speculation into operational transparency. A casino that wishes to prove every bonus‑derived donation is legitimate can deploy a smart contract on a public ledger such as Ethereum or Polygon.

When a player accepts a 50 % reload bonus, the platform’s middleware writes a transaction to the blockchain:

  1. PlayerBonusID – Unique hash linking the bonus to the user account.
  2. AllocatedAmount – Calculated community share (e.g., 3 % of the bonus).
  3. DestinationWallet – Pre‑approved NGO address.

Because the contract is immutable, no operator can later alter the allocation amount without triggering a visible event. Auditors and even curious players can query the contract using a block explorer and see, in real time, that $12,340 of bonus funds have been sent to a children’s education fund in Dubai.

Real‑World Auditable Example

A UK‑based betting site reviews its blockchain logs once a month and publishes a CSV snapshot on its “Transparency Hub.” The file lists each transaction ID, player segment (VIP, regular, casual), and the charitable cause funded. Players can filter the data to see how many free spins they personally helped convert into a donation.

The technical benefits are threefold:

  • Verifiability – Independent third parties can confirm the flow of funds without relying on the casino’s internal reports.
  • Reduced Reconciliation Costs – Automated settlement eliminates manual bank transfers and associated fees.
  • Enhanced Trust – In markets where gambling faces social stigma, showing a public ledger can improve brand perception.

For operators not ready to adopt a full blockchain solution, a hybrid approach using off‑chain databases synced with periodic on‑chain snapshots can deliver most of the transparency benefits while keeping transaction costs low.

4. Integrating Responsible‑Gaming Tools into Bonus Mechanics

Responsible gaming (RG) is no longer an afterthought; it is woven into the bonus architecture itself. Modern platforms embed RG parameters directly into bonus codes, ensuring that protective measures activate automatically when risk thresholds are breached.

Technical Embedding of RG Controls

  • Self‑Exclusion Flag – When a player opts into self‑exclusion, the bonus engine tags the account with a “RG_SelfExcl” flag. Any pending bonus claim is rejected, and the system logs the event for compliance reporting.
  • Loss Limit Trigger – The back‑end continuously monitors net losses. If a player’s loss exceeds a preset limit (e.g., €2,000 in 30 days), the engine sets a “BonusHold” state, suspending further bonus eligibility until the player initiates a cooling‑off period.
  • Session Timer – A timer starts when a bonus is activated. After a defined session length (e.g., 2 hours), the system automatically expires the bonus, prompting the player to either restart a new session or accept a reduced bonus value.

These controls are implemented via a rule‑based microservice that intercepts bonus requests. Pseudocode example:

IF Player.RG_Flag = TRUE OR Player.Losses > Limit THEN
   Deny Bonus
ELSE
   Grant Bonus
END IF

Dual Benefit: Player Protection and Community Funding

When a bonus is withheld due to RG triggers, the associated community allocation is not lost. Instead, the platform redirects the earmarked amount to the community fund, ensuring that the charitable budget remains intact while the player receives protection.

A concise bullet list of RG‑bonus interactions:

  • Self‑exclusion – Bonus denied, community share retained.
  • Loss limit breach – Bonus paused, community allocation held.
  • Session timeout – Bonus expires, unused community portion added to fund.

By integrating these safeguards at the code level, casinos reduce the risk of problem gambling, comply with regulatory standards in the UAE and EU, and simultaneously boost the size of their social‑impact pool.

6. Partnerships with NGOs and Local Charities – Technical Coordination

Connecting a casino’s community fund to real‑world NGOs requires more than a simple bank transfer. Modern integrations rely on APIs, secure data exchange, and rigorous compliance checks.

API‑Based Fund Transfer

  • OAuth 2.0 Authentication – Casinos obtain a token from the NGO’s payment gateway, ensuring that only authorized services can initiate transfers.
  • Payload Structure – A JSON payload includes fields such as donation_id, amount, currency, and purpose_code. Example:
{
  "donation_id": "C2024-00123",
  "amount": 1500,
  "currency": "AED",
  "purpose_code": "EDU_CHILD"
}
  • Idempotency Keys – Prevent duplicate payments if the network retries.

Compliance Layer

  • KYC/AML Verification – Before funds are released, the NGO’s system validates the source of the money against sanctions lists and verifies the casino’s licensing status.
  • Regulatory Reporting – Automated generation of CSV reports that satisfy the gambling authority’s charitable‑donation disclosure requirements.

Seamless Workflow Example

  1. Bonus pool allocation for the day is calculated (e.g., $25,000).
  2. The system divides the amount among three partner NGOs based on pre‑negotiated percentages.
  3. Each split triggers an API call to the NGO’s endpoint.
  4. The NGO returns a confirmation receipt, stored in the casino’s audit log.
  5. A daily summary email is sent to the compliance officer and posted on the transparency portal.

A bullet list of the technical steps:

  • Compute daily community allocation.
  • Authenticate with each NGO via OAuth.
  • Send idempotent JSON payloads.
  • Record receipt and update internal ledger.
  • Generate regulator‑compliant reports.

By automating these steps, the casino eliminates manual bottlenecks, reduces error rates, and provides a frictionless experience for both the operator and the charitable partner.
